The David Johnston – Lebovic Foundation International Experience Awards are now open to international, national, undergraduate, masters, and PhD students from all academic disciplines at the University of Waterloo in Canada.

 

 

The David Johnston – Lebovic Foundation International Experience Awards are a highly esteemed scholarship opportunity provided by the University of Waterloo. The purpose of these prizes is to enable students to engage in international experiences that extend beyond conventional classroom education.

The David Johnston – Lebovic Foundation abroad Experience Awards seek to offer financial assistance to University of Waterloo students who are enthusiastic about expanding their perspectives through abroad experiences. These prizes enable students to fully immerse themselves in global learning opportunities such as studying abroad, participating in international co-op programmes, or engaging in global research initiatives.

 

Recipients of these awards are granted financial aid, the amount of which is contingent upon the particular programme and the expenses associated with the foreign endeavour. The financial assistance aims to alleviate the financial strain commonly associated with studying or working in a foreign country.

Scholarship Benefits: You can receive financial assistance ranging from $2,500 to $10,000 to enhance your school path through a variety of experiences:

Academic Adventures: If you are preparing for a single-term study abroad programme, you have the opportunity to receive a maximum of $2,500 in financial assistance to help defray the expenses and enhance the accessibility of your international study experience.
Professional Pursuits: Individuals who are interested in engaging in practical employment or volunteer opportunities for a limited duration can get a cash incentive ranging from $2,500 to $5,000. This support is intended to facilitate career growth and broaden one’s perspectives.
Extended participation: If you are undertaking a longer two-term work or volunteer assignment, you have the opportunity to receive up to $10,000, which will provide you with significant financial support to fully maximise your global participation.
